During a professional facial treatment, the esthetician does more than just apply masks and serums; they act as a guide through the complex world of dermatology. The manual extraction process, professional-grade exfoliation, and lymphatic drainage massage included in a session serve to detoxify the skin and stimulate collagen production. These techniques require a high level of skill to avoid scarring or inflammation, which is why the professional setting is so vital. Furthermore, the immediate “glow” post-treatment is often supported by the use of technologies like LED light therapy or microcurrents, which provide a non-invasive lift and accelerate the healing process of the skin tissues.
